'A Taste of River Cruising'
On the Douro - day 3
A leisurely cruise followed by a coach tour up to UNESCO World Heritage Site Castelo Rodrigo. This evening we're moored about three metres inside Spain, at the end of the navigable Douro.

The Gloria Funicular in Lisbon in June this year. The cars balance each other, so seeing the footage showing one car right at the lower end of the short line suggests the other car, which crashed, possibly came adrift when it was nearing the top. #lisbon
